     45 /*
     46 **  RAM SOME OBJECT
     47 **
     48 **	You have run into some sort of object.  It may be a Klingon,
     49 **	a star, or a starbase.  If you run into a star, you are really
     50 **	stupid, because there is no hope for you.
     51 **
     52 **	If you run into something else, you destroy that object.  You
     53 **	also rack up incredible damages.
     54 */
     55 
     56 void
     57 ram(ix, iy)
     58 int	ix, iy;
     59 {
     60 	int		i;
     61 	char		c;
     62 
     63 	printf("\07RED ALERT\07: collision imminent\n");
     64 	c = Sect[ix][iy];
     65 	switch (c)
     66 	{
     67 
     68 	  case KLINGON:
     69 		printf("%s rams Klingon at %d,%d\n", Ship.shipname, ix, iy);
     70 		killk(ix, iy);
     71 		break;
     72 
     73 	  case STAR:
     74 	  case INHABIT:
     75 		printf("Yeoman Rand: Captain, isn't it getting hot in here?\n");
     76 		sleep(2);
     77 		printf("Spock: Hull temperature approaching 550 Degrees Kelvin.\n");
     78 		lose(L_STAR);
     79 
     80 	  case BASE:
     81 		printf("You ran into the starbase at %d,%d\n", ix, iy);
     82 		killb(Ship.quadx, Ship.quady);
     83 		/* don't penalize the captain if it wasn't his fault */
     84 		if (!damaged(SINS))
     85 			Game.killb += 1;
     86 		break;
     87 	}
     88 	sleep(2);
     89 	printf("%s heavily damaged\n", Ship.shipname);
     90 
     91 	/* select the number of deaths to occur */
     92 	i = 10 + ranf(20 * Game.skill);
     93 	Game.deaths += i;
     94 	Ship.crew -= i;
     95 	printf("McCoy: Take it easy Jim; we had %d casualties.\n", i);
     96 
     97 	/* damage devices with an 80% probability */
     98 	for (i = 0; i < NDEV; i++)
     99 	{
    100 		if (ranf(100) < 20)
    101 			continue;
    102 		damage(i, (2.5 * (franf() + franf()) + 1.0) * Param.damfac[i]);
    103 	}
    104 
    105 	/* no chance that your shields remained up in all that */
    106 	Ship.shldup = 0;
    107 }
